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Oversee the development and execution of SEO strategy (technical, on-page, off-page, and content) for our diverse client partners.
  • Keep the agency at the forefront of the industry, pivoting strategies in response to search engine updates, generative AI search behaviors, and evolving user intent.
  • Manage, mentor, and grow a team of SEO Strategists. Conduct regular 1-on-1s, setting performance expectations, building a high-performance culture, and foster a collaborative, continuous-learning culture.
  • Responsible for team capacity planning, prioritization, and ensuring resources are aligned appropriately across client work.
  • Refine and scale the agency’s SEO framework, internal tool sets and deliverable templates to maintain high quality and efficiency.
  • Collaborate with Marketing Services and Client Success teams on service opportunities, high-level organic audits and growth projections for new and prospective client partners.
  • Key Accountabilities:
  • Team Leadership, Management and Accountability (LMA)
  • SEO Strategy Innovation and Service Quality
  • Client Organic Performance ROI
  • Department Profitability and Resource Capacity
  • Scoping Accuracy

Requirements

  • 7+ years of dedicated SEO experience, with at least 3+ years leading an SEO team.
  • Deep understanding of technical SEO (site architecture, schema markup, Core Web Vitals, crawling and indexing issues) and content optimization strategies.
  • Deep understanding of content topical authority and the evolution of user-centric intent.
  • Proven track record of driving measurable organic growth, revenue impact, and search visibility improvements across diverse client portfolios.
  • Exceptional ability to explain technical SEO concepts to non-technical client stakeholders and executives.
  • Expert-level proficiency with tools like Ahrefs, semrush, Google Search Console, Google Analytics 4 (GA4), and Looker Studio.

Preferred

  • Digital marketing agency experience preferred.
